Synthesis and physicochemical studies of nickel(II) complexes of 2-substituted-1,3-diphenyl-1,3-propanedione, their 2,2′-bipyridine and 1,10-phenanthroline adducts and x-ray structure of (2,2′-bipyridine)bis(1, 3-diphenyl-1, 3-propanedionato) nickel(II)

The nickel(II) complexes of 2-substituted-1,3-diphenyl-1,3-propanedione and their 2,2′-bipyridine and 1,10-phenanthroline adducts have been prepared and characterized by microanalysis, conductance, magnetic and spectral measurements. The conductance data in nitromethane indicate that the compounds are non-electrolytes. The room temperature magnetic moments suggest that they are magnetically dilute compounds. The electronic spectra revealed the π3-π4 bathochromic shifts, which were observed upon chelation while the infrared spectra showed the different shifts of the carbonyl frequencies. The X-ray crystallography showed that nickel ion is coordinated by two units of 1,3-diphenyl-1,3-propanedione and a unit of bipyridine giving it a six coordinate octahedral geometry.
